<p>Words: Henry F. Lyte, 1847.</p>
<p>Music: Eventide, William H. Monk, 1861.</p>
<p>Story bihind the Song: This tune was written at a time of great sorrow when together we watched, as we did daily, the glories of the setting sun. As the last golden ray faded, he took some paper and penciled that tune which has gone all over the earth.</p>
<p>Lyte was inspired to write this hymn as he was dying of tuberculosis; he finished it the Sunday he gave his farewell sermon in the parish he served so many years. The next day, he left for Italy to regain his health. He didn’t make it, though he died in Nice, France, three weeks after writing these words. Here is an excerpt from his farewell sermon:</p>
<p>O brethren, I stand here among you today, as alive from the dead, if I may hope to impress it upon you, and induce you to prepare for that solemn hour which must come to all, by a timely acquaintance with the death of Christ.</p>
<p>For over a century, the bells of his church at All Saints in Lower Brixham, Devonshire, have rung out “Abide with Me” daily. The hymn was sung at the wedding of King George VI, at the wedding of his daughter, the future Queen Elizabeth II, and at the funeral of Nobel peace prize winner Mother Teresa of Calcutta in1997.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Words: Fanny Crosby, 1868.</p>
<p>Music: W. Howard Doane.</p>
<p>Story behind the song:  On April 30, 1868, Dr. W. H. Doane came into my house and said, “I have exactly forty minutes before my train leaves for Cincinnati.</p>
<p>Here is a melody. Can you write words for it?” I replied that I would see what I could do. Then followed a space of twenty minutes during which I was wholly</p>
<p>unconscious of all else except the work I was doing. At the end of that time I recited the words to “Safe in the Arms of Jesus.” Mr. Doane copied them, and</p>
<p>had time to catch his train. -- Crosby</p>
<p>This song was played on Augu<a class="biblegateway_link" href="http://www.biblegateway.com/passage/?search=st+8%2C+1885" target="_new">&#115;&#116;&#32;&#56;&#44;&#32;&#49;&#56;&#56;&#53;</a>, when U.S. President Ulysses S. Grant was laid to rest in Riverside Park, on the banks of the Hudson River. </p>

<p>Words: Elizabeth C. Clephane, 1868.</p>
<p>Music: Ira D. Sankey, 1874.</p>
<p>Story behind the song<strong>:</strong>  Sankey spotted these words in a British newspaper while on an evangelism tour in Scotland with Dwight Moody. He tore the poem from the paper, put it in his pocket, and forgot about it. Later that day, at the end of their service in Edinburgh, Moody asked Sankey for a closing song. Ira was caught by surprise, but the Holy Spirit reminded him of the poem in his pocket. He brought it out, said a prayer, then composed the tune as he sang. Thus was born “The Ninety and Nine.” This was Sankey’s first attempt at writing a hymn tune. Not bad for a first try!</p>
<p>Many years ago there lived at Northfield [Massachusetts] an infidel; and one day, while all the neigh­bors had gone to the meeting at the church, he sat at home alone feeling dissa­tis­fied with him­self and all the world in gen­er­al. But he heard Mr. Sankey sing­ing “The Nine­ty and Nine”; and there was some­ thing in the hymn that he could not es­cape. The mel­o­dy rang in his ears, and the thought of the lost sheep trou­bled him that night, and the next, and the fol­low­ing day un­til the ev­en­ing, when he could stand it no long­er. He went to the meet­ing and re­turned a saved man. A few years lat­er he was tak­en ill. One day he said to his wife, “Raise the win­dow; I hear ‘The Nine­ty and Nine.’” Then he list­ened at­tent­ive­ly un­til the last notes of the hymn had died out; and turn­ing from the win­dow he said, “I am dy­ing; but it is all right, for I am rea­dy. I shall ne­ver hear ‘The Nine­ty and Nine’ again on earth, but I am glad that I have heard it once more to­day.”</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Story of the Song:</strong> &#8220;Onward, Christian Soldiers&#8221; is a 19th century English hymn. The words were written by Sabine Baring-Gould in 1865, and the music was composed by Arthur Sullivan in 1871. Sullivan named the tune &#8220;St. Gertrude,&#8221; after the wife of his friend Ernest Clay Ker Seymer, at whose country home he composed the tune.</p>
<p>The theme is taken from references in the New Testament to the Christian being a soldier for Christ, for example II Timothy 2:3 &#8220;Thou shalt endure hardness, as a good soldier of Jesus Christ.&#8221; The Salvation Army adopted the hymn as its favoured processional.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Story behind the Song:</strong></p>
<p>Miss Charlotte Elliott was vi­sit­ing some friends in the West End of Lon­don, and there met the em­i­nent min­is­ter, Cé­sar Ma­lan. While seat­ed at sup­per, the min­is­ter said he hoped that she was a Christ­ian. She took of­fense at this, and re­plied that she would ra­ther not dis­cuss that quest­ion. Dr. Ma­lan said that he was sor­ry if had of­fend­ed her, that he al­ways liked to speak a word for his Mas­ter, and that he hoped that the young la­dy would some day be­come a work­er for Christ. When they met again at the home of a mu­tu­al friend, three weeks lat­er, Miss Ell­i­ott told the min­is­ter that ev­er since he had spok­en to her she had been try­ing to find her Sav­iour, and that she now wished him to tell her how to come to Christ. “Just come to him as you are,” Dr. Ma­lan said. This she did, and went away re­joic­ing. Shortly af­ter­ward she wrote this hymn.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Story Behind the Song:</strong><br />
Words &amp; Music: Traditional English carol, possibly dating from as early as the 13th Century. This combination of tune and lyrics first appeared in Christmas Carols, Ancient and Modern, by William Sandys (London: Richard Beckley, 1833).</p>
